The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 67839 zip code. The total population is 1020, of which, 525 are male and 495 are female. With a total area of 1411.111 square miles, the population density is 0.9 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 46.2 years old. Education
In the 67839 zip code, 95%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 23.7%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 67839 zip, there are an estimated 576 people in the labor force, of which, 576 are employed, and 0 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 17.9 minutes. Of the total people that work, 41 worked from home and 549 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 41.4. Housing
The median home value for the 67839 zip code is 78700. There is an estimated 467 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$423 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$524.
